Anyone ever come across an 8000 series with an agri data dash? I remember seeing one on ebay a few years ago for 600. It was brand new like it had been taken out of an 8000 and set on a shelf for years. I also remember seeing a real rough 8000 series on ebay once that still had one in it. I have a pile of sales brochures on them. I know it was a flop. But still a neat part of history.

If I remember correctly, they only made 50 of those and AC eventually bought them all back and replaced them with a standard dashboard......too much trouble and downtime issues.

Seems like Norm Swinford talks about them in his book. I wonder what was the unreliable part, the dash or the various sensors? If a person knew what the values were for the sensors were (If that is the issue) they could probably be retrofitted with late model automotive sensors.

The sealing art/technology for the sensors hadn't progressed far enough, at that time, to make them reliable in farm environments. There were also some EMI/RFI issues when operating near high voltage power lines. That was something else that wasn't well understood at that time.
